When converting binary to decimal, a common mistake is misplacing the fractional point. Remember, each digit represents increasing powers of 2 as you move left (positive) and decreasing powers of 2 as you move right (negative). Make sure to double-check that you're applying the correct power for every bit in the sequence. With practice, you'll turn binary numbers into decimal with ease, avoiding those pesky errors!
